Why Live in Luther Corner

Luther Corner in Swansea, Massachusetts, blends historic charm with suburban convenience. The neighborhood, once a bustling 19th-century commercial hub, is now a residential area featuring Cape Cod, colonial, and occasional ranch-style homes, all shaded by mature maple trees. The historic Luther Store, a convenience shop since 1815, still stands and is listed on the National Register of Historic Places. Residents enjoy outdoor activities in the surrounding open fields and leafy trees, with Swansea Town Beach and Swansea Park offering recreational spaces. The closest green space is the Touisset Marsh Wildlife Refuge, a 66-acre preserve open year-round. Dining and shopping are concentrated around Route 6, with local features like County Fare Too Coney Island Hot Dogs and Del's Lemonade. Many residents also frequent Downtown Warren for its burgeoning restaurant scene, including The Wharf, an upscale seafood restaurant. Golfers can visit the nearby Touisset Country Club, featuring a 9-hole course. The neighborhood is well-connected, with Route 6 and Interstate 195 providing access to larger areas like Fall River and Providence, which is about 14 miles away. The Rhode Island TF Green International Airport is approximately 20 miles away. Schools in the Swansea Public School District are highly rated, and Joseph Case Senior High School's marching band has won multiple championships. Luther Corner boasts lower crime rates than the national average, making it a safer place to live.

Frequently Asked Questions

Is Luther Corner a good place to live?
Luther Corner is a good place to live. Luther Corner is considered car-dependent and somewhat bikeable. Luther Corner is a suburban neighborhood with a crime score of 1, making it safer than the average neighborhood in the U.S. Luther Corner has 7 parks for recreational activities. It is sparse in population with 1.3 people per acre and a median age of 47. The average household income is $125,038 which is above the national average. College graduates make up 29.1% of residents. A majority of residents in Luther Corner are home owners, with 14.2% of residents renting and 85.8% of residents owning their home. How much do you need to make to afford a house in Luther Corner?
The median home price in Luther Corner is $392,500. If you put a 20% down payment of $78,500 and had a 30-year fixed mortgage with an interest rate of 6.74%, your estimated principal and interest payment would be $2,030 a month plus property taxes, HOA fees, home insurance, PMI, and utilities. Using the 28% rule, you would need to make at least $87K a year to afford the median home price in Luther Corner. The average household income in Luther Corner is $125K.
